وحدة المعالجة المركزية CPU تعريفها وأجزائها وطريقة عملها

Spread the love

وحدة المعالجة المركزية أو ما يعرف باسم المعالج إحدى أهم أجزاء أجهزة الكمبيوتر المسؤولة عن كافة المهام التي يقوم بها الجهاز. لذلك أول ما يسأل عنها من يرغب بشراء جهاز جديد لتحديد الأداء والسرعة بشكل عام.

من أشهر الأنواع المتداولة بما يخص وحدات المعالجة المركزية ما يعرف باسم Intel، وحتى تعلم ما الذي تشير إليه مواصفات هذه المعالجات لا بد في البداية من تقديم كل ما يتعلق بها من معلومات تفصيلية.

بالنسبة لي تبقى سرعة المعالج أول ما يلفت انتباهي عند رؤية جهاز كمبيوتر جديد. حيث على أساسها يمكنني تقدير إن كان هذا الجهاز ملائما أم لا.

ستجد في هذه السطور تعريفًا بتلك المعالجات ومكانها مع وصف خارجي بسيط. كما ستتعرف على أهميتها ودورها الأساسي في عمل الكمبيوتر. ولا تنسى تفصيل طريقة عملها ومكوناتها أيضا.

ما هي وحدة المعالجة المركزية

  • وحدة المعالجة المركزية يرمز لها CPU اختصارا لعبارة Central Processing unit وهي الجزء الرئيسي من الكمبيوتر المسؤول عن تنفيذ كافة التعليمات فيه. حيث تتكفل بتنفيذ كافة العمليات الحسابية والمنطقية والعمليات الأساسية الخاصة بالإدخال/الإخراج.
  • تبلغ أهمية وحدة المعالجة المركزية لدرجة كبيرة يراها الخبراء كالدماغ بالنسبة للكمبيوتر؛ فكل تعليمة كبيرة كانت أم صغيرة يجب أن تتم عن طريقها. على سبيل المثال عند النقر على أحد زري الماوس أو الضغط على أحد مفاتيح لوحة المفاتيح Keyboard يجب أن يظهر الحرف عن طريق ال CPU.
  • عند شراء جهاز كمبيوتر أول ما ستنظر إليه هو وحدة المعالجة هذه والتي يقال لها اختصارًا بالمعالج والذي يدل على سرعة عمل الجهاز ككل.
    لكن ذلك لا يعني أن الكمبيوتر هو فقط من يحتوي على وحدة معالجة مركزية CPU؛ بل تتواجد في الهواتف الذكية، والساعات الرقمية الذكية، جهاز ألعاب الفيديو بل وحتى في السيارات الحديثة المزودة بلوحة تحكم بالقيادة.
  • باختصار كل جهاز الكتروني حديث يتضمن وحدة معالجة مركزية أو ما يعرف اختصارًا بـ CPU.
  • أخيرًا بقي أن أدلك على مكان وحدة المعالجة هذه في الكمبيوتر، حيث ستجدها في اللوحة الأم motherboard. تتصل معها بواصة مقبس خاص بها إلى جانب جهاز تبريد خاص مهمته منع ارتفاع حرارتها أثناء العمل.

مكان تواجد وحدة المعالجة المركزية

  • بمجرد أن تنظر إلى مكونات جهاز الكمبيوتر أو اللابتوب الداخلية وتحديدًا إلى اللوحة الأم ستشاهد وحدة المعالجة CPU موجودة في مكان مخصص لها ومتصلة باللوحة الأم بواسطة مقبس خاص بها.
  • أما شكل وحدة المعالجة مربعة وصغيرة مع العديد من الموصلات المعدنية القصيرة والمستديرة على جانبها السفلي. لكن إن كانت قديمة نوعا ما فستجد بدلا من الموصلات مجموعة من الدبابيس.
  • تصنع وحدة المعالجة من مادة السيراميك بطول 2 بوصة وتتخللها صفيحة سيليكون بداخلها. يغطيها جهاز مشتت للحرارة مهمته امتصاص الحرارة منها لتبريدها؛ فكما هو معروف يتأثر عمل وحدة المعالجة بالحرارة.
  • يمكن إزالة كل من وحدة المعالجة والمبرد لاستبدالهما في حال العطب مع ضرورة مراعاة توافقها مع اللوحة الأم. بمعنى آخر قد تضطر عند استبدال المعالج CPU بآخر أحد إلى استبدال اللوحة الأم أيضا.
  • بقي الإشارة إلى استحالة نزع وحدة المعالجة في اللاب توب وبالتالي لن تتمكن من تغييرها أو تغيير اللوحة الأم أيضا.

اقرأ أيضا: برنامج لاصلاح الفلاش ميموري واستعادتها لحالة المصنع – تحميل من رابط مباشر

أهمية وحدة المعالجة المركزية

  • تكمن أهمية وحدة المعالجة المركزية في أنها تقوم بتنفيذ كافة عمليات المعالجة الخاصة بالنظام بأكمله. بالتالي بدونها لن يتمكن جهاز الكمبيوتر من تنفيذ أي عملية مهما كانت.
  • فكل إجراء يتخذ وكل عملية ضغط على أحد المفاتيح لا بد أن تنفذها وحدة المعالجهة هذه. وهنا يذكر أن أداءها يختلف باختلاف عدد المعالجات الموجودة فيها والتي تعرف بالنوى.

وظيفة الـ CPU

  • كما ذكرت لك سابقًا يمكن القول أن وحدة المعالجة CPU بمثابة الدماغ للكمبيوتر كونها تتحكم بتسغيله وعمل كل أجزائه.
  • بشكل مفصل أكثر تعمل وحدة المعالجة المركزية على استلام التعليمات وفك تشفيرها ثم تنفيذها بالاعتماد على مجموعة من التعليمات المبرمجة مسبقًا وهذا ما يدعى بدورة التعليمات.
  • علاوة على ذلك يقع على عاتق المعالج عمليات إحضار البيانات والكتابة عليها.

اقرأ أيضا: حل مشكلة الفلاش ميموري لا تقبل الفورمات – التهيئة

مكونات وحدة المعالجة المركزية

من الطبيعي لا بل من المحتم إذا ما أردنا الحديث عن أي شيء خاصة في مجال التكنولوجيا أن نسأل عن مكوناته لنفهم أكثر ماهيته وطريقة عمله واستخداماته.
تعرف وحدة المعالجة المركزية CPU أنها مكونة من تلاثة أقسام رئيسية هي:

  • وحدة المنطق الحسابي.
  • وحدة التحكم.
  • ذاكرة التخزين المؤقت.

في بداية صناعة وحدات المعالجة المركزية كانت تتكون من عدة أجزاء منفصلة؛ لتتطور صناعتها لاحقا وتصبح قطعة واحدة متكاملة تدعى المعالج الدقيق microprocessor. بالتالي أصبح من الصعب رؤية مكوناتها من الخارج.

وحدة المنطق الحسابي ALU

  • يرمز لها ALU اختصارا لعبارة Arithmetic logic unit. وهي جزء من وحدة المعالجة المركزية مسؤول عن تنفيذ جميع العمليات الحسابية والمنطقية أيضا المتعلقة بكافة المهام التي يتلقاها الكمبيوتر.
  • بدورها تنقسم هذه الوحدة إلى الوحدة المنطقية ويرمز لها LU وإلى الوحدة الحسابية ويرمز لها AU. لكن في بعض المعالجات (CPU) يتم وضع أكثر من وحدة حسابية لكل منها مهمتها الخاصة.
  • يذكر أنه يوجد معالج ثانوي رقمي عبارة عن شريحة منفصلة مهمتها إجراء حسابات الفاصلة العائمة.

وحدة التحكم CU

  • يرمز لها CU اختصارا لمصطلح Control Unit عبارة عن دارة خاصة مهمتها توجيه وإدارة العمليات التي تتم ضمن وحدة المعالجة المركزية.
  • بمعنى آخر تتمثل مهمة وحدة التحكم هذه بتوجيه كل من الوحدة المنطقية LU والذاكرة وأجهزة الإدخال والإخراج لتتمكن من تلقي المعلومات القادمة من البرنامج والتعامل معها بالشكل الصحيح.

يمكن اختصار دور وآلية عمل وحدة التحكم

  • تلقي المعلومات القادمة من وحدات الإدخال.
  • معالجة تلك المعلومات وتحويلها إلى إشارات تحكم.
  • إرسال الإشارات إلى المعالج المركزي الذي تقع على عاتقه مهمة توجيه الأجهزة لتنفيذ التعليمات المطلوبة.

ذاكرة التخزين المؤقت Cache

  • هي المكون الثالث من مكونات وحدة المعالجة المركزية حيث تحتوي ال CPU على طبقة واحدة أو أكثر من ذاكرة التخزين المؤقت. وتعتمد عليها في الوصول إلى ذاكرة الوصول العشوائي RAM كونها أسرع منها.
  • يمكن تلخيص عملها بتخزين البيانات والإرشادات، وبالتالي لن تحتاج وحدة المعالجة المركزية للانتظار لاسترداد البيانات المطلوبة من ذاكرة الوصول العشوائي RAM.
  • بمعنى آخر عندما تحتاج وحدة المعالجة المركزية إلى البيانات (بما فيها تعليمات البرنامج) تعمل ذاكرة التخزين المؤقت على تحديد مكان هذه البيانات وإرسالها لها.
  • تعتمد في نقل البيانات من ذاكرة الوصول العشوائي RAM على خوارزميات تنبؤية حيث تحلل البيانات المطلوبة منها وتخزنها فيها بحيث تقدمها بشكل أسرع لوحدة المعالجة المركزية.

اقرأ أيضا: ترتيب ألوان سلك النت – وكيفية تجعيد كابلات إيثرنت المخصصة الخاصة بك بأي طول

كيفية عمل وحدة المعالجة المركزية

بالرغم من التقدم المستمر في صناعتها، بقي مبدأ عمل وحدة المعالجة المركزية كما هو يقوم على ثلاث مراحل:

  • إحضار البيانات.
  • فك التشفير.
  • التنفيذ.

إحضار البيانات

  • حتى تقوم وحدة المعالجة المركزية بجلب البيانات المطلوبة، لا بد لها أن تتلقى تعليمات محددة. تتمثل تلك التعليمات على هيئة سلسلة من الأرقام ترسلها ذاكرة الوصول العشوائي إلى المعالج.
  • تتكون العملية الواحدة من عدد من التعليمات المرتبطة ببعضها؛ لذلك يجب على وحدة المعالجة أن تتعرف على جميع التعليمات.
  • يحفظ عداد البرنامج عنوان التعليمات الحالي، ويوضعا ضمن سجل التعليمات IR.
  • يزداد بعد ذلك طول العداد للإشارة لعنوان التعليمات المتتالية.

فك التشفير

  • في هذه المرحلة تمرر وحدة المعالجة التعليمات المخزنة إلى دائرة تدعة وحدة فك ترميز التعليمات.
  • فيتم تحويل التعليمات إلى إشارات ثم تمرر إلى أجزاء أخرى من وحدة المعالجة.

التنفيذ

  • هي الخطوة الأخيرة التي ترسل خلالها التعليمات إلى الأجزاء المتعلقة بها ضمن وحدة المعالجة ليتم إكمالها.
  • تسجل النتائج ضمن سجل وحدة المعالجة المركزية، ليتاح الرجوع لها لاحقًا عن طريق تعليمات أخرى.

اقرأ أيضا: تركيب فيشة النت وترتيب الألواب بها بالطريقة الصحيحة

العمليات التي تقوم بها وحدة المعالجة المركزية

تعمل وحدة المعالجة (المعالج) على تنفيذ التعليمات الخاصة بمجموعة من العمليات الأساسية. من بينها العمليات الحسابية مثل الجمع والطرح والضرب والقسمة.

يتم نقل البيانات من مكان إلى آخر، وتختبر العمليات المنطقية ثم يتخذ القرار بناء على النتيجة. كل هذه العمليات هي المسؤولة عن أداء الكمبيوتر للعديد من الوظائف؛ بالتالي تتحكم وحدة المعالجة المركزية بكفاءة الكمبيوتر.

استخدام المعالج للذاكرة

  • لا تعتبر الذاكرة جزءا من وحدة المعالجة المركزية، لكنها ضرورية جدا بالنسبة لها. حيث يتواجد في الكمبيوتر نوعين من الذاكرة: رئيسية وثانوية لكل منها دور محدد.
  • ما يهمنا الآن الإشارة إلى اعتماد المعالج على الذاكرة الرئيسية في تخزين تعليمات البرنامج والبيانات الضرورية للتعليمات. أما الذاكرة الثانوية فهي وحدة التخزين الدائمة متمثلة بمحركات الأقراص الثابتة والمحمولة.
  • تعمل وحدة التحكم CU ضمن المعالج على نقل التعليمات والبيانات من التخزين الثانوي إلى الذاكرة الرئيسية قبل تنفيذ التعليمات. بعد ذلك تعيد نقل نتائج التعليمات إلى الذاكرة الثانوية.

المعالجات الدقيقة لوحدة المعالجة المركزية

  • يطلق عليه Microprocessor عبارة عن شريحة تتضمن عددا من الدوائر المسؤولة عن التحكم بجميع عمايات الكمبيوتر. يتم تنفيذ كل وظيفة من وظائف وحدة المعالجة CPU بشريحة واحدة فقط وهو ما يعتبر أقل من ناحية التكاليف وأكثر موثوقية نتيجة لاستخدام الدوائر المتكاملة.
  • سابقًا كانت توضع وحدة المعالجة على دائرة تتضمن شرائح متعددة؛ أما الآن فتتضمن الشريحة الواحدة عددا من وحدات المعالجة التي يشار إليها باسم النوى.

اقرأ أيضا: حل مشكلة الصوت في ويندوز 7 بشكل نهائي.

شراء وحدة المعالجة المركزية CPU

عند شراء اللاب توب أو جهاز الكمبيوتر المكتبي يجب حسن اختيار العديد من الأمور من بينها المعالج (وحدة المعالجة) حتى وإن كنت تعمل على استبدالها فقط.
أكثر نوعين مشهورين من المعالجات هما: Intel Core و AMD Ryzen. ويعتمد نوع المعالج على الأعمال التي ستقوم بها لاحقا مثلًا:

  • بالنسبة للأعمال المكتبية وتصفح الإنترنت يعتبر معالج Intel Core i3 أو AMD Ryzen3 خيارًا جيدًا.
  • أما بالنسبة للألعاب يفضل استخدام معالج core i5 أو corei7 أو Ryzen 5/7.
  • بينما ينصح من يرغب بالقيام بأعمال برمجية معقدة مثل تحرير الصور 4k وإنشاء الرسوم المتحركة بالاعتماد على معالج Intel core i9 أو AMD Ryzen 9.
  • ناحية أخرى يجب أخذها بعين الاعتبار هي الجيل الخاص بالمعالج حيث ينصح أن يكون حديثًا مثلًا في معالجات AMD وصلت الشركة المصنعة إلى معالجات من الجيل 5000، بينما وصلت شركة انتل كور إلى الجيل الحادي عشر. لذلك احرص على اختيار جيل متقدم قادر على تلبية المهام التي تريدها.
  • اقرأ أيضا: حل مشكلة توقف منافذ اليو أس بي عن العمل في الكمبيوتر

أشهر الشركات المصنعة لوحدة المعالجة المركزية

سأبد لك بما يخص عالم الهواتف المحمولة التي لا بد وأنك قد سمعت بأنواع وحدات المعالجة المركزية الأربعة الشهيرة وهي:

شركة إنتل Intel

وحدة المعالجة المركزية

 

تطور هذه الشركة الرائدة في مجال الصناعات الإلكترونية مجموعة كبيرة ومتنوعة من المعالجات الخاصة بالأجهزة المحمولة. مثل وحدات المعالجة المركزية m3 ذات الأداء المنخفض والمستخدمة في أجهزة chromebook إضافة لمعالجات Intel core i9 الجبارة القادرة على تشغيل أضخم الألعاب وأعقد المهام.
كما كان للأجهزة الخفيفة والمضغوطة نصيب من إنتاج الشركة من خلال معالجات Intel Lakefield المستخدم في أجهزة Galaxy Book S.

شركة AMD

وحدة المعالجة المركزية

من أكبر المنافسين لشركة انتل حيث تقدم مجموعة متنزعة من المعالجات (وحدة المعالجة المركزية) الخاصة بالهواتف المحمولة وأجهزة الكمبيوتر. تتضمن معالجات نوع C-Series ونوع Athlon الخاصة بأجهزة Chromebook.

كما بدأت معالجات من نوع Ryzen بالاستخدام بشكل أكبر خاصة في أجهزة اللاب توب المصممة للألعاب الضخمة. بالرغم من قلة انتشار معالجات AMD مقارنة بمعالجات Intel إلا أن ذلك لا يسمح لأحد بإنكار أداة هذه المعالجات المميز.

شركة Qualcomm Snapdragon

هي شركة مختصة بانتاج وحدة معالجة مركزية خاصة للهواتف العاملة بنظام التشغيل اندرويد، مع أنها انتقلت حديثا إلى عالم الكمبيوتر.
بالرغم من أدائها المنخفض الناتج عن استخدام تقنية Arm تعتبر رقائق Snapdragon مميزة بطول عمر البطارية.

شركة Apple Silicon

شركة حديثة العهد في مجال صناعة وحدة المعالجة المركزية الخاصة بأجهزة الهواتف المحمولة؛ حيث قررت الاستغناء عن خدمات شركة انتل وتطوير معالجات خاصة بها لأجهزة MacBooks. بالنسبة لما طورته الشركة حتى الآن يمكن القول أنه اقتصر على شريحة M1 الخاصة بجهاز MacBook ذات الأداء الرائع مقارنة مع ما تقدمه شركتي AMD و Intel.

هذا بالنسبة لأجهزة الهاتف المحمول؛ أما بما يخص أجهزة الكمبيوتر واللاب توب يمكن القول أن ما من منافس لشركتي Intel و AMD نهائيًا في مجال صناعة وحدة المعالجة المركزية (بانتظار ما ستقدمه شركة ابل مستقبلًا). لا يمكن الجزم بأن إحدى الشركتين هي الأفضل، فعلى الرغم من الاختلاف في التصميم بين المعالجات إلا أنها تتشابه من حيث الأداء بنفس السعر.

أما بما يخص أحدث إصدارات انتل هي معالجات Rocket Lake؛ بينما Ryzen 5000 هي الأحدث من شركة AMD.

وعن أوجه الفرق بينهما فيمكن القول أن معالجات Intel تهتم بسرعات التردد مما يجعلها الخيار الأفضل للألعاب. بينما تهتم معالجات AMD وخاصة نوع Ryzen بزيادة عدد النوى والخيوط بالتالي أداء متعدد الخيوط منقطع النظير.

اقرأ أيضا:

سعر جهاز core i7 ومواصفاته

حل مشكلة بطئ الكمبيزتر ويندوز 7 وتسريع نظام التشغيل بطرق سهلة وبسيطة.

اترك رد

لن يتم نشر عنوان بريدك الإلكتروني.